Following the exit of Mariah Carey, Randy Jackson and Nicki Minaj, FOX has announced that Connick Jr., returning judge Keith Urban, and Jennifer Lopez—who was an Idol judge in 2011 and 2012—will scour the country together for music’s next big thing. According to FOX’s chairman of entertainment:
“American Idol has always been about discovering the next singing superstar, and next season our judging panel will deliver a most impressive combination of talent, wisdom and personality to do just that: Jennifer Lopez, the triple-threat global superstar who loves and whom Idol fans love; Harry Connick Jr., a bona-fide musical genius and fantastic Idolmentor whose honesty and expertise can help turn these hopefuls into stars; Keith Urban, a multi-Grammy-winning artist who was such a positive force on the show last season. We are also very excited to have our friend Randy Jackson now in a new role as mentor, and the captain of our team – the heart and soul of Idol – Ryan Seacrest returning as host.”
